Welcome to Cherryville ...

Cherryville is located in Clackamas County<1>.


The location of Cherryville has been provided by the Geographic Names Information System (ie- the GNIS).<2>


While we don't have a date for the founding of Cherryville, you might consider that their post office opened  in 1884.

Cherryville is 1,270 feet [387 m] above sea level.<3>.

Time Zone: Cherryville lies in the Pacific Time Zone (PST/PDT) and observes daylight saving time

Area codes for Cherryville: (503) and (971)<4>

Adding Cherryville to Our Gazetteer ...

We originally found mention of Cherryville in both the FIPS-55 and the GNIS. For more information, see the FIPS and GNIS Codes sections on our Miscellaneous Page.

From our notes, the earliest published mention we've found for Cherryville was in the document titled List of Post Offices from Cameron Blevins and Richard Helbock.<6>

From that list, the Cherryville post office opened in 1884.

We also found Cherryville in the book titled Business Atlas and Shippers' Guide (1895).
